

What vpns on github really mean and how to use them safely is a topic that often causes confusion, especially for first-time readers. In short, it’s about understanding what VPNs on GitHub are, how to evaluate them, and the best practices for using them securely. Here’s a quick guide to get you set up safely and confidently.
- Quick fact: GitHub hosts many community-built VPN projects, but not all are trustworthy. You should verify source code, reviews, and the maintainers before you run anything on your devices.
Introduction: quick guide to the topic
What vpns on github really mean and how to use them safely? In this video and guide, you’ll learn what to look for, how to verify code, and how to stay safe while using or testing VPN configurations you find on GitHub. This post is designed to be a practical, step-by-step resource with real-world tips, checklists, and examples so you don’t get burned by risky forks or outdated dependencies.
- What you’ll learn:
- How to identify reputable VPN projects on GitHub
- How to audit code for security and privacy risks
- How to test VPN configurations safely
- How to avoid common scams and insecure practices
- How to set up a personal VPN using trusted sources
Useful resources text only
Apple Website – apple.com
Artificial Intelligence Wikipedia – en.wikipedia.org/wiki/Artificial_intelligence
GitHub Security Best Practices – docs.github.com/en/github/authenticating-to-github/about-commit-signature-verification
OpenVPN Community – openvpn.net
WireGuard Official – www.wireguard.com
NordVPN – nordvpn.com
Mozilla VPN – vpn.mozilla.org
Tor Project – www.torproject.org
Electronic Frontier Foundation – www.eff.org
Understanding what “VPNs on GitHub” really means
VPNs on GitHub usually refer to open-source VPN software, configuration scripts, or learning resources shared by developers. These can include:
- Open-source VPN clients and servers e.g., WireGuard, OpenVPN
- Infrastructure as code for deploying VPN services Ansible, Terraform
- Community guides and demo configurations
- Forks of existing projects with added features or tweaks
Why open-source matters here
- Transparency: anyone can review the code, which helps surface security flaws.
- Community fixes: active maintainers push updates, patches, and security improvements.
- Learning opportunities: you can study how VPNs are built and configured.
However, there are pitfalls
- Malicious forks: bad actors may publish compromised code or steganographic malware
- Outdated dependencies: old libraries can introduce vulnerabilities
- Misconfigurations: even good code can be risky if deployed incorrectly
How to evaluate a GitHub VPN project
Use a simple, repeatable checklist:
- Maintainer credibility: check the profile, activity, and number of contributors
- Repository health: look for recent commits, open issues, and active pull requests
- Documentation quality: clear install steps, security considerations, and change logs
- Security practices: presence of code signing, CI checks, and vulnerability scans
- Usage model: is it meant for personal use, enterprise deployment, or learning?
- Licensing: ensure you understand what you’re allowed to do and how to attribute
- Community signals: stars aren’t everything, but thoughtful issues and responses matter
Quick score method Openvpn not working on windows 11 heres how to fix it fast
- 0–2: Low trust; look for another project
- 3–5: Caution; review in detail
- 6–8: Generally solid; proceed with care
- 9–10: High confidence; good candidate for use
Common VPN architectures you’ll find on GitHub
- WireGuard-based VPNs: small, fast, modern, uses simple cryptography
- OpenVPN deployments: traditional, highly configurable, broad client support
- Tailscale/ZeroTier-like networks: mesh networks for easy device-to-device connectivity
- VPN-as-a-service scripts: automations to spin up VPN servers in cloud environments
- Tunnels and proxies: not full VPNs, but useful for specific use cases
Understanding these architectures helps you pick the right tool for your needs and avoids overengineering simple tasks.
How to securely use VPNs from GitHub
A practical, safety-first approach:
- Use trusted sources only
- Prefer official projects or highly recommended community forks with active maintenance
- Review the code yourself
- Look for hard-coded credentials, insecure defaults, or unusual network behavior
- Check recent activity
- Avoid projects with long periods of no updates or unresolved critical issues
- Test in a controlled environment
- Use virtual machines or isolated networks before deploying on real devices
- Verify cryptographic details
- Ensure strong algorithms, up-to-date protocols, and proper key management
- Keep dependencies up to date
- Regularly update libraries and components to patch known vulnerabilities
- Monitor for anomalies
- After deployment, watch traffic, logs, and performance for unusual activity
- Follow privacy implications
- Understand what logs the VPN might retain and who can access them
- Respect licensing and terms
- Ensure you’re compliant with the project’s license when deploying or modifying
- Have a rollback plan
- Know how to revert changes if you detect a security issue
Step-by-step guide: testing a VPN codebase from GitHub
- Step 1: Clone the repository from a trusted source
- Step 2: Read the README thoroughly, then skim the setup script
- Step 3: Inspect the installation and configuration files
- Step 4: Build in a sandbox VM or container
- Step 5: Run the VPN in a test environment with non-production data
- Step 6: Validate encryption, authentication, and leak tests
- Step 7: Document your findings and decisions
- Step 8: If all good, plan a staged rollout with continuous monitoring
Real-world performance and security data
- VPN adoption stats: The global VPN market reached $35 billion in 2024, with steady growth expected into 2026 and beyond.
- Security incidents: A significant portion of VPN-related breaches come from misconfigurations rather than zero-day flaws.
- WireGuard vs OpenVPN: WireGuard generally offers higher speeds and simpler configuration, while OpenVPN provides deep configurability and broad compatibility.
- Leakage tests: DNS leaks and IP leaks remain common risks; always verify leak protection in both IPv4 and IPv6 modes.
- Audit findings: Many open-source VPN projects lack formal third-party security audits; prioritize projects that publish audit reports or use public CVE programs.
Table: quick comparison of common VPN approaches you’ll encounter on GitHub
| VPN Type | Ease of Setup | Performance | Customization | Platform Support | Security Notes |
| WireGuard | Easy to moderate | High | Moderate | Cross-platform | Modern protocol, simple, needs key management |
| OpenVPN | Moderate | Good | High | Broad | Mature, wide options, slower by default |
| Mesh/ZeroTier-like | Easy | Good | High | Cross-platform | Peer-to-peer networking, different security model |
Best practices for choosing and using VPNs found on GitHub
- Favor official client integrations over ad-hoc scripts
- Prefer projects with transparent changelogs and security advisories
- Prefer well-documented authentication methods and key management
- Use reproducible builds or containerized deployments to minimize drift
- Practice defense in depth: combine VPN with host firewall rules and network monitoring
- Consider privacy-first projects that minimize data retention and telemetry
Common mistakes to avoid
- Running binaries from unknown forks without review
- Ignoring certificate pinning and key rotation policies
- Overlooking IPv6 and DNS leak protections
- Deploying in production without a rollback or backup plan
- Relying on a project with minimal maintainers and no security disclosures
How to stay updated with evolving VPN standards
- Follow official protocol recommendations RFCs for OpenVPN and WireGuard
- Watch for CVE disclosures and security advisories from the project
- Subscribe to security mailing lists and GitHub security alerts
- Participate in community discussions to stay aligned with best practices
Practical use cases
- Personal privacy: a lightweight WireGuard setup to secure your home network traffic
- Remote work: a secure tunnel for employees to access corporate resources
- Bypassing throttling: legitimate use where allowed by your ISP and terms of service
- Safe testing: a sandbox environment for testing new networks or scripts
Quick-start checklist
- Identify a reputable GitHub VPN project
- Read the documentation and security notes
- Audit critical files for sensitive data exposure
- Spin up a test environment VM/container
- Validate cryptography and leak protections
- Implement monitoring and logging
- Document the deployment and rollback steps
- Keep everything updated and audited
Community signals to gauge trust
- Active issue discussion with timely responses
- Clear contribution guidelines and code of conduct
- Public security advisories and versioned releases
- Evidence of automated tests and vulnerability scanning
Advanced topics for power users
- Automated deployment pipelines for VPNs using IaC Terraform, Ansible
- Integrating VPNs with CI/CD for secure development environments
- Multi-hop VPN configurations for added privacy
- Zero-trust networking concepts in VPN setups
Security testing techniques you can apply
- Static code analysis for sensitive data exposure
- Dependency vulnerability scanning Snyk, Dependabot, etc.
- Unit and integration tests focused on authentication and encryption
- Penetration testing in a controlled lab environment
- Privacy impact assessment for data retention and telemetry
Tools and resources that help
- GitHub Security Lab resources
- Open-source vulnerability scanners for CI pipelines
- VPN-specific security guides from reputable organizations
- Container security best practices for deploying VPNs in isolated environments
Maintenance and long-term care
- Schedule periodic reviews of code, dependencies, and security advisories
- Maintain up-to-date backups and disaster recovery plans
- Ensure keys and certificates are rotated on a defined schedule
- Keep your monitoring dashboards aligned with current traffic patterns
Real-world examples and case studies
- Case study: A small business moved to WireGuard-based VPN, reduced latency by 20% and simplified management
- Case study: A developer tested an OpenVPN fork in a VM lab and identified outdated cryptographic parameters that required update
- Case study: A college lab used Terraform to deploy a campus-wide VPN for student access with strict access controls
FAQ Section
What does “VPNs on GitHub” mean in simple terms?
VPNs on GitHub refer to open-source VPN software, configurations, or learning materials shared on GitHub. They can be legitimate and helpful or risky if misused or poorly maintained. Gm vpn login your step by step guide to accessing gms network: Quick, Clear, and Safe VPN Access
Should I trust a GitHub VPN project automatically?
No. Trust is earned through maintainers, recent activity, robust documentation, security audits, and clear issue tracking. Do your due diligence.
How can I verify the security of a GitHub VPN project?
Review commit history, read through security advisories, check for third-party audits, verify dependencies, and test in a controlled environment before any production use.
What are common security risks with GitHub VPN projects?
Misconfigurations, outdated dependencies, embedded credentials, weak cryptography, and lack of proper key management.
How do I test a VPN project safely?
Set up a sandbox environment VM or container, run the project with non-production data, verify leak protection, and monitor traffic and logs.
Can I deploy a GitHub VPN project in production?
Only after thorough review, testing, and a formal risk assessment. Prefer projects with strong maintenance and security practices. 터치 vpn 다운로드 무료 vpn 이것만 알면 끝 pc 모바일 완벽 가이드
What is the difference between WireGuard and OpenVPN?
WireGuard is lightweight, fast, and simple to configure; OpenVPN is feature-rich and highly configurable but can be slower and more complex.
How do I avoid phishing or malicious forks?
Stick to well-known repositories, review maintainers’ profiles, and avoid downloading binaries from unknown forks. Use reputable sources and double-check.
Are there licensing concerns I should know about?
Yes. Read the license to understand usage rights, attribution, and if commercial use is allowed, especially in organization settings.
How often should I update VPN configurations?
Regularly—ideally whenever updates are released that fix security vulnerabilities or improve privacy. Establish a routine for monitoring and applying updates.
What are best practices for key management in GitHub VPN projects?
Use ephemeral keys for testing, rotate keys frequently, store keys in secure vaults, and avoid embedding keys in code or configuration files. Unlock TikTok Globally: The VPNs That Actually Work in 2026
Is it safe to use a VPN project for remote work?
Yes, if the project is secure, well-maintained, and properly configured with strong authentication, access controls, and monitoring.
How do I learn more about VPN security basics?
Start with official protocol documentation WireGuard, OpenVPN, read security best-practice guides from trusted sources, and follow security-focused forums and communities.
Can I contribute to GitHub VPN projects safely?
Absolutely. Contribute by fixing bugs, writing tests, improving documentation, and sharing security findings responsibly. Follow the project’s contribution guidelines.
What should I do if I suspect a VPN project is unsafe?
Stop using it, report your concerns to the maintainers, and consider removing references from your environment until you have a safe alternative.
How do I balance usability and security in a GitHub VPN setup?
Aim for sensible defaults that emphasize security but keep configuration approachable. Provide clear, concise docs and offer guided setup paths. Nordvpn on your iphone in china your step by step guide to staying connected
NordVPN is recommended as a trusted option when you want a safer, audited experience for everyday use, and you can explore more about it here: NordVPN
Sources:
Cyberghost vpn for microsoft edge extension 2026
性价比机场推荐:2026年精选与选购指南,最全买机票与机场体验攻略
14 Best Google Alternatives Private Search Engines For 2026 ⚠️ 토마토 vpn 무료 다운로드 안전하고 빠른 사용법과 주의점 a to z
